MEASUREMENT PRINCIPLE The PSS i60 is a full-flow particulate sampling system used to collect particulates from the diluted exhaust gas on a filter during a test cycle. At the beginning and end of the test cycle, the filter is weighed and the particulate mass is calculated and the background application is considered (gravimetric-measurement). APPLICATION The CVS full-flow dilution based particulate mass determination is also the reference for partial flow determinations. The PSS i60 SD is used for l ight duty and passenger car chassis dynos. For heavy-duty and off-road engine testbeds the double dilution version PSS i60 DD is used. Appl ications for engine performance and emission development, certification and conformity of production (COP) are fully covered with the PSS i60. The system is used on transient and stationary engine testbeds for R&D, certification and quality control as well as on chassis dynos for HD vehicles.
